Frequently Asked Questions about Albuquerque
How much are Studio apartments in Albuquerque?
There are currently 677 Studio Apartments in Albuquerque with rent ranges from $645 to $2,701 with an average price of $998.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Albuquerque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Albuquerque ranges from $500 to $2,490 with an average monthly rent of $1,297.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Albuquerque c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Albuquerque range from $749 to $3,634.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,589.
How expensive are Albuquerque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 196 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Albuquerque on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,066 to $5,494 - averaging $2,084 for the location.
